The European Data Summit 2024 was a high-profile event focused on the integration of data, AI, and data spaces, particularly in sectors such as mobility, transport, and tourism. Held on 21 May 2024, it brought together key players in Europe to discuss innovative approaches to data sharing and collaboration, emphasizing secure and interoperable frameworks. The summit showcased how data spaces can enhance industries by enabling new service models, improving artificial intelligence applications, and fostering innovation across multiple domains.
The CyclOps project, aligned with Horizon Europe’s goals, participated in the summit as part of its efforts to highlight advancements in managing data lifecycles and promoting FAIR (Findable, Accessible, Interoperable, Reusable) principles. CyclOps focused on demonstrating its automated tools for end-to-end data management, particularly their applications within European data spaces. This includes use cases in tourism, mobility, the Green Deal, and public procurement.
During the summit, CyclOps highlighted its emphasis on breaking data silos, promoting trust, and enabling interoperability in data sharing. These goals align with the overarching objectives of the European Data Strategy, aiming to enhance innovation, sustainability, and data sovereignty in Europe.
